Introduction of Employees' Compensation in California
Workers' settlement in The golden state is developed to support staff members that suffer job-related injuries or health problems. This system supplies benefits that can help workers pay for medical costs and shed incomes, guaranteeing they receive required care and support during healing.
History and Function
The workers' payment system in The golden state began in the early 20th century. It aimed to offer a fair way to work out work environment injury insurance claims without the requirement for claims. Before this system, damaged employees dealt with lots of difficulties in acquiring payment.
The law was created to protect both employees and companies. It enables workers to obtain prompt benefits while limiting companies' obligation. This method encourages safe working environments and promotes sector requirements that prioritize employee security.
Scope and Coverage
The golden state legislation covers most employees, consisting of full time, part-time, and seasonal workers. The requirements for insurance coverage can differ based on the kind of employer and the nature of the job.
Workers have to report injuries within a details timespan to qualify for advantages. Covered injuries usually consist of mishaps, repetitive strain injuries, and work-related diseases. Advantages might include clinical therapy, short-term disability repayments, and work retraining, which assist employees go back to work asap.
Eligibility and Insurance Claims Refine
To receive workers' settlement in California, it is very important to recognize who is eligible and exactly how to effectively file a claim. The process has clear steps that employees have to comply with to ensure they receive the benefits they are entitled to.
Identifying Eligibility
To receive employees' settlement, a worker must meet specific requirements. Initially, the individual needs to be a staff member, not an independent contractor. This consists of both full-time and part-time employees.
In addition, the injury must have occurred while performing job-related tasks. This means that if a worker is injured while flattering their work, they are generally eligible. Injuries can be physical or psychological.
Lastly, the company needs to have employees' payment insurance. Many companies in The golden state are needed to carry this coverage. If an employee is not sure regarding their eligibility, they can seek advice from a legal expert to obtain guidance.
Filing a Claim
The claim declaring process begins with the worker notifying their company about the injury. This notification must be done as soon as possible, ideally within 1 month of the injury.
After informing the company, the worker has to submit a claim kind referred to as DWC 1. This kind gathers details about the injury and need to be submitted to the employer within one year from the date of injury.
As soon as the employer obtains the claim, they have 2 week to react. If they accept the case, benefits will start. If they deny it, the employee can appeal the choice. Keeping in-depth records of all communications and records is important.
Case Assessment
After declaring, the case will certainly be reviewed by the insurance provider. They will certainly assess the details to figure out if the case stands. This assessment may include collecting medical records and witness declarations.
The insurance policy adjuster will get in touch with the employee for any kind of added information. This could involve asking questions regarding the injury or asking for more documents.
Based upon their searchings for, the insurance company will make a decision whether to accept or refute the insurance claim. If authorized, the employee will get benefits to cover medical expenses and shed wages. If refuted, the employee deserves to challenge the choice with a formal process.
Advantages and Payment
Workers' payment in California provides important benefits to staff members that are harmed on the job. Key advantages include medical therapy expenses, disability advantages, and extra task displacement aid.
Medical Therapy Costs
Clinical treatment costs are covered for staff members who experience work-related injuries. This consists of required medical care such as medical professional sees, healthcare facility stays, surgical procedures, and rehab. Injured workers can pick their medical service provider from a checklist offered by their company or through the state's employees' settlement insurance coverage.
Employees should report their injury without delay to get these advantages. The insurer typically pays the clinical bills directly. This assists ensure that hurt employees obtain timely care without included financial stress.
Handicap Advantages
Handicap benefits support workers that can not do their work because of injury. California offers 2 kinds: short-lived and long-term handicap advantages.
Temporary impairment assists workers that are not able to help a restricted time. They obtain concerning two-thirds of their ordinary once a week incomes, covered at a state-defined optimum quantity.
Long-term special needs advantages are offered to those who have enduring impacts from their injuries. The amount is based on the severity of the disability and the employee's earning ability. This insurance coverage help workers in handling financial obligations while recouping.
Supplemental Work Displacement
Supplemental job variation advantages are offered to workers incapable to go back to their previous work as a result of an injury. If a worker qualifies, they obtain a voucher to use for re-training or education.
The worth of the voucher can differ according to the injury's conditions. This choice allows hurt workers to find out new abilities and seek various job opportunity. It is important for those aiming to shift back right into the workforce.
These advantages help wounded workers restore their ground and preserve financial stability after a job-related injury.
Legal Structure and Conflict Resolution
Employees' compensation in The golden state is controlled by a particular collection of guidelines and laws. Understanding these legislations and the procedure for fixing disagreements is vital for both staff members and companies. This section covers state guidelines and the allures procedure involved in workers' payment insurance claims.
State Regulations
California's workers' payment system is largely controlled by the Labor Code. This code outlines the legal rights of hurt employees and the duties of companies.
Crucial element consist of:
- Mandatory Insurance: Most employers should bring workers' compensation insurance coverage.
- Benefit Types: Hurt workers may obtain treatment, disability settlements, and trade rehabilitation.
- Claims Process: Employees must report injuries promptly and file claims within a specific duration.
The Department of Workers' Compensation (DWC) oversees these laws. It additionally supplies info and assistance to those associated with the system. Comprehending these policies helps people navigate their rights and duties successfully.
Appeals Process
If an employee disagrees with a choice concerning their claim, they can appeal. The allures process in The golden state workers' settlement entails a number of actions.
- Request for Hearing: An employee can file an ask for a hearing with the Workers' Settlement Appeals Board (WCAB).
- Hearing: A court will certainly carry out a hearing where both parties can provide proof.
- Decision: After the hearing, the court issues a decision that can be appealed further if needed.
It is essential for employees to collect all relevant documents and evidence before appealing. This prep work can significantly affect the end result of their case.
